Output 57c2a7dafa86f436433e60c3566cb6645cca07e590d9f10f4235501c75ae0c4f:0

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21fb9f3dbae1e5729462f54346998776cd5a871 OP_EQUAL
address
3HvrD5QxY7MkTTJiSVCeBcRVGGH7wTqVJE
transaction
57c2a7dafa86f436433e60c3566cb6645cca07e590d9f10f4235501c75ae0c4f
spent
true